An open label, single-arm, single-center study to evaluate the safety, efficacy and feasibility of haplo-SCT as an alternative donor source for patients who lack a matched sibling/unrelated donor options. The choice of the chemotherapy treatment for transplantation will be up to the investigator. Post-transplant cyclophosphamide will serve as the backbone of the immunosuppression treatment to prevent GVHD. GVHD Prevention Treatment: Cyclophosphamide will be administered IV on Day 3 and Day 5 post transplant. Tacrolimus will be administered IV until patient can take it by mouth starting on day of transplant and continue approximately 100 days post-transplant. Mycophenolate mofetil will be administered IV until patient can take it by mouth starting on Day 1 post transplant until 28 days.
